Both Steam and Source have been rumored to be coming to Linux for years. Linux games are probably the biggest need when it comes to Linux software, along with having people adopt OS's like Ubuntu for their desktops at home. So Valve's recent announcement that Steam & Source will soon be running natively on Linux is a huge deal for gamers like me. I can't wait to load up Steam in Ubuntu.
